They were selling for $80 which was a fantastic value in my opinion. Doesn't take up alot of room. Stackable. 20 year shelf life. My buckets were made in April.
everything needs water to rehydrate- cook and use. ALSO you need a cooking source as you only get a small --fireSTARTER-- package---NOT a stove or fuel source to cook any of this. it's a starter pack but you need much more to make this carb laden bucket of use. a bucket full of $1.00 Knorr side dishes and water will provide similar value for less... but this is supposed to be for long time storage--until the bucket is opened-- then it is just like any other store bought food item. $140.00+ will buy a lot of dried food packages off the shelf that will last a long time also. no meat or sweets enclosed either.
